Subject: Turnstile Counter Cut-over Complete

Team,

The Harrowfield Arena turnstile counter moved to the new Gatesum service last night. We ran both systems in parallel for three match days; counts diverged by fewer than four entries per gate, all attributable to manual overrides. Old hardware polling is disabled, and the audit log now captures every increment. For your review, the production service runs with the following configuration.

deployment values, yadup-kadug:
[sorys]
port = 5672
team = noveth
host = sorys.orvexcorp.example
region = south-4
access_code = ac_deddc1
timeout_ms = 1500

Heads up, support folks: after the Quillbase 4.2 rollout, some customers may see slow reports — the query planner is picking a bad join order on wide tables. Workaround: have them add the planner hint from the macro list, or we can toggle the legacy planner per account. Symptoms, canned replies, and the toggle steps are all documented at:

dashboard of kafof-tahaf = https://confluence.tolvaqsys.internal/projects/browse/display/a1250987

// Autocomplete queries against the Tindervale index got slow once plugin
// vocabularies passed ~200k terms. Root cause: per-keystroke trie rebuilds.
// We now rebuild incrementally and debounce lookups. Plugin authors should
// not trigger manual index refreshes; the scheduler batches them. If your
// plugin still sees latency spikes, lower your suggestion fan-out before
// filing a ticket with the Ostrel team. The constants below control debounce
// timing, batch size, and rebuild thresholds.

tuning constants:
RATE_LIMITS = {
    "wenwyn": 1,
    "zorix": 10,
    "oliix": 2,
    "holael": 10,
}

**CI note: timezone weirdness in report exports**

Heads up, support folks — if a customer says their Ledgerpine export shows times shifted by a few hours, it's probably the CI image. The export workers got rebuilt last week and the base image defaults to UTC, while older workers used the account's locale. Fix is rolling out; meanwhile tell customers the data itself is fine, just the display offset. Affected exports carry the build token shown below.

build token for bajof-tahop: htk4_a981